This review is from: The Walther Handgun Story: A Collector's and Shooter's Guide (Paperback)
This book offers a lot of info but however, it should be mentioned that the pictures are generally of a very poor quality as a result of which the distinguishing of (important !) details is hardly or not at all possible. The (few) drawings are of an even worse quality. Also the chapter covering the P88 and P99 models is inadequate (notably for the P99)and the subtitling of the pictures sometimes is completely wrong. Nevertheless this book has to be considered worth its price because, again, it offer lots of info (especially on prewar models)and it reads in an agreeable way.

This review is from: The Walther Handgun Story: A Collector's and Shooter's Guide (Paperback)
This is a rather well thought out book...IF you're a collector on the vintage pistols.
Although the photos could have been of a better brightness and contrast, they do serve to show a fairly comprehensive history of the Walther pistols. It would have been nice to see some movie and TV tie-ins to show how prevalent the Walther name has been on the large and small screens. What I would take exception with is the way the P99 was handled. An updated edition is warranted and would serve to remedy this oversight. The same can be said for the Walther line of airguns, be they pellet or BB pistols. Not a bad book, considering there is nothing else on the market that delves into the history and legacy of the Walther name in firearms.
